#b1714c - Not Yet Caramel color

This shade is a warm, muted russet, a rich cinnamon-meets-copper tone with deep terracotta and brown undertones. It reads cozy and grounded, like sun-warmed clay, aged leather, or spiced cinnamon sugar. Slight orange warmth keeps it lively while the brown depth makes it sophisticated and earthy. It suits autumnal palettes, vintage decor, and rustic interiors, pairing beautifully with cream, olive, navy, or brass accents for a comforting, elegant atmosphere.

color #b1714c

#b1714c color RGB value is 177, 113, 76, and the CMYK value is 0.00, 0.362, 0.571, 0.306. Alternative names for that color are: not yet caramel, tan, sienna, cape palliser, sepia, orange.
